  39 inline void oopDesc::update_contents(ParCompactionManager* cm) {
  40   // The klass field must be updated before anything else
  41   // can be done.
  42   DEBUG_ONLY(Klass* original_klass = klass());
  43 
  44   Klass* new_klass = klass();
  45   if (!new_klass->oop_is_typeArray()) {
  46     // It might contain oops beyond the header, so take the virtual call.
  47     new_klass->oop_update_pointers(cm, this);
  48   }
  49   // Else skip it.  The TypeArrayKlass in the header never needs scavenging.
  50 }
  51 
  52 inline void oopDesc::follow_contents(ParCompactionManager* cm) {
  53   assert (PSParallelCompact::mark_bitmap()->is_marked(this),
  54     "should be marked");
  55   klass()->oop_follow_contents(cm, this);
  56 }
  57 
  58 inline oop oopDesc::forward_to_atomic(oop p) {
  59   assert(ParNewGeneration::is_legal_forward_ptr(p),
  60          "illegal forwarding pointer value.");
  61   markOop oldMark = mark();
  62   markOop forwardPtrMark = markOopDesc::encode_pointer_as_mark(p);
  63   markOop curMark;
  64 
  65   assert(forwardPtrMark->decode_pointer() == p, "encoding must be reversable");
  66   assert(sizeof(markOop) == sizeof(intptr_t), "CAS below requires this.");
  67 
  68   while (!oldMark->is_marked()) {
  69     curMark = (markOop)Atomic::cmpxchg_ptr(forwardPtrMark, &_mark, oldMark);
  70     assert(is_forwarded(), "object should have been forwarded");
  71     if (curMark == oldMark) {
  72       return NULL;
  73     }
  74     // If the CAS was unsuccessful then curMark->is_marked()
  75     // should return true as another thread has CAS'd in another
  76     // forwarding pointer.
  77     oldMark = curMark;
  78   }
  79   return forwardee();
  80 }
